Beta
×

Welcome to the Slashdot Beta site -- learn more here. Use the link in the footer or click here to return to the Classic version of Slashdot.

Thank you!

Before you choose to head back to the Classic look of the site, we'd appreciate it if you share your thoughts on the Beta; your feedback is what drives our ongoing development.

Beta is different and we value you taking the time to try it out. Please take a look at the changes we've made in Beta and  learn more about it. Thanks for reading, and for making the site better!

Comments

top

How To Get a Game-Obsessed Teenager Into Coding?

Zork the Almighty OpenGL (704 comments)

Code a simple example in OpenGL. It's fairly easy to get started. Get a tetrahedron on the screen. Then make it bounce and spin and deform in real time.

more than 4 years ago
top

Are You a Blue-Collar Or White-Collar Developer?

Zork the Almighty Re:It's about social status... (836 comments)

Just face it, you're getting too old for slashdot :) About half the people arguing with you are just trying to justify all the money they spent or are spending on education. Yes, you need calculus in academic disciplines, including computer science. You also need it in highly technical or scientific fields, like rocketry, engineering, image processing, etc. Of course, learning computer science does not necessarily teach anyone how to make good software, and in some cases an inverse correlation may be observed.

I think it's really sad how our society basically devalues skilled labour. That's what writing good software is, after all. The attitude of businesses seems to be that people are more or less replaceable and therefore expendable, and people have responded by outrageously increasing their qualifications. This costs society a lot of money in wasted time, lost productivity, lost income, and stunted career progression. The quality of education has also deteriorated under the extremely high demand. This is inflation in education: the amount of it goes up as its value drops.

It does not make sense for most software developers to have a four year computer science degree. It's hard to see what they could need beyond a solid understanding of algorithms and data structures, and exposure to different programming languages. You could learn it in two years, but it would be quite hard. Or you could learn the basics in one year and do a year of apprenticeship and two years as a journeyman to get it all. But it doesn't work that way anymore, because a great many businesses refuse to bear the costs of educating their employees. It's stupid short-term thinking, and they pay for it in other ways, but all of the career risk has been pushed onto the labour force.

So what are you missing? The value of an education is really what you make of it. I guess the best way to explain it is with an analogy. If you were to get an English degree you would study Shakespeare. It may or may not help you write a good play. If you were talented, you might pick up something from Shakespeare. Or you could study Shakespeare with great dedication, and practice writing until your work really compares. Or you could bullshit, plagiarize, and plead your way though a degree and go on to write travesty after travesty to be inflicted on an unsuspecting public. In any case, someone with a BA in English had better know Shakespeare. That's just expected, because it's part of a body of knowledge. It may or may not be related to the skills that employers are looking for.

Universities exist to maintain and expand bodies of knowledge. That's it. To the extent that they have been used as a "shortcut" for employee training or certification, it is highly unfortunate and detrimental to society as a whole. I wouldn't deny the right of an education to anyone, but society has misconstrued its purpose.

more than 4 years ago
top

Is There a Future For Mature Games On Wii?

Zork the Almighty "mature" game does not mean good game (186 comments)

Too many games are retarded, and a lot of people who play them are probably retarded too. It's like any other form of mass entertainment. Supposedly "mature" games are mostly mindless violence. I think "mature" means "appeals to 13 year olds instead of 10 year olds" here. It's one or two steps up from "My Pony Party". Do you want a good game for the Wii? Try Muramasa. It has a good story, incredible art, and it's a lot of fun to play. Is that a mature game? I would say so. It's a lot more mature than sawing people to death (what the hell?). Developers: stop complaining that your retarded shit doesn't sell. I'm sure lots of even more retarded shit sells like hotcakes, and that seems mighty unfair, but nobody cares nor should they care. Try making something that isn't totally brain dead.

more than 4 years ago
top

Best Home Backup Strategy Now?

Zork the Almighty home users (611 comments)

Backup your internal HDD to an external one, and if your data is really important, have two externals and swap one off-site once a week.

For the vast majority of home users this is still the best advice.

more than 5 years ago
top

Tech Or Management Beyond Age 39?

Zork the Almighty management (592 comments)

Ageism in tech is very real, and even if you're not seeing it yet, you will in another 10 years. By that time it will be too late. Get on the management track while you can.

more than 5 years ago
top

SLI on Life Support on the AMD Platform

Zork the Almighty nvidia dying (2 comments)

Nvidia is just pissing on everyone. Who is going to buy their chips ? Not AMD users (duh), and when Larrabee ships they will face stiff competition from Intel. And they don't have a future generation game console. How does a hardware company think it can act like this and survive ?

more than 5 years ago
top

AMD's Six-Core Istanbul Opterons

Zork the Almighty Re:Another test at anandtech.com (123 comments)

Hyperthreading shows you eight fake cores which map to four real cores. I benchmarked it extensively. Computationally intensive routines with a small memory footprint can gain up to 20%. Bandwidth or memory intensive routines can lose up to 50%. In the extreme case, 8 threads on virtual cores can be half the speed of 4 threads on 4 real cores on a Core i7. Keep in mind, this is on a crazy application that generates lots of data.

If your algorithm is designed to break up the problem to exploit the cache then hyperthreading is a bigger mess. The data for thread 1 and thread 2 (out of 8) might be complementary, but the operating system will run those threads different actual cores, because all it sees is the virtual cores. This can be very inefficient if you need the whole cache.

Perhaps worst of all, you are stuck always running 8 threads. 2-6 threads may not be distributed evenly across the real cores, leading to inconsistent performance. Therefore, you may lose performance by attempting to scale the problem further than it is efficient to do so. With real cores, I can decide (based on problem size) the correct number of core to use.

In conclusion, hyperthreading has its uses, but operating systems are oblivious to it and that's a major problem with more than one core.

more than 5 years ago
top

Intel Recruits TSMC To Produce Atom CPUs

Zork the Almighty Intel (109 comments)

Atom cpus are not especially profitable. They're cheap. Intel is handing them off to TSMC and probably hoping like hell that the market still craves high performance. Unless more software is parallelized, things are going to be bad!

Note: I parallelized my software and the Core i7 is awesome. Superlinear speedup is easy to achieve with a dedicated L2 cache. The Phenom II would also give great performance. So I would bet that Atom and other underpowered cpus are a fad. They will not look very good next to a mobile Core i7 that is 20x faster when all cores are used.

more than 5 years ago
top

A Teacher Asking Students To Destroy Notes?

Zork the Almighty advice (931 comments)

Tell her to fuck off. Seriously, is this a joke ? Why would you let her go through your binder ? Do you just do anything someone says to be nice ? Go to her office and demand your notes back. Don't leave until she gives them to you. Take it up with the head department. Ask them what kind of fucking crock "school" they have. Is it a degree mill where you pay for a piece of paper ? You can get those with mail order you know. What a fucking joke.

more than 5 years ago
top

45nm Phenom II Matches Core 2 Quad, Trails Core i7

Zork the Almighty Re:AMD is back????? (234 comments)

I disagree. AMD is in an ok position, not great obviously, but their platform is competitive. The Core i7 is a better processor than the Phenom II, but I don't expect its price to come down any time soon. Intel will milk the high margins for as long as they can and sell old Core 2 quads to consumers for at least this year.

Given the choice between a Core 2 Quad and a Phenom II, you should pick the Phenom. No question about it. The Core 2 quad has a split cache so multithreaded performance is crap. The cores have to transfer data through the slow memory interface, which limits parallel speedup in a lot of cases. This wasn't really an issue when Intel released the processor, but in the near future it will be a serious issue because the parallel software is coming.

more than 5 years ago
top

Black Holes Lead Galaxy Growth

Zork the Almighty economy (50 comments)

"Black Holes Lead Galaxy Growth" - this is great news for our economy.

more than 5 years ago
top

Bank Julius Baer Issues Statement On WikiLeaks

Zork the Almighty News coverage (187 comments)

Did anyone see the Associated Press coverage? link.

"An effort at damage control has snowballed into a public relations disaster for a Swiss bank seeking to crack down on a renegade Web site for posting classified information about some of its wealthy clients."

Apparently, company information is "classified information", and WikiLeaks is a "renegade" website. I guess it is compared to the Associated Press. Here's a high school example of propaganda. Perhaps it was written by a high school student.

more than 6 years ago

Submissions

Zork the Almighty hasn't submitted any stories.

Journals

top

Good OS X Programs

Zork the Almighty Zork the Almighty writes  |  more than 9 years ago Here is a list of my favorite Mac OS X programs, which I use on a regular basis. Feel free to post your own, but to get on my list programs must be freeware or open source, and they must use native widgets.

FFview - an image viewer. Great for large, organized photo collections (see my iPhoto rant earlier). Designed for reading manga.

MPlayer OSX 2 - _the_ movie player. Handles everything, no questions asked. I don't even bother with that quicktime shit.

Adium X - IM client. Connects to all the networks I care about. Small and unintrusive if you change the dock icon. Themeable. Very nice program.

Frozen Bubble - game. More like an addictive, polished game. A must have for any platform.

Temperature Monitor - self explanatory. I leave this running, because I like seeing graphs of sensors. This guy makes lots of other great software too. Be sure to check out TinkerTool.

Ogg Vorbis Quicktime components - lets you play .ogg files in iTunes.

top

Apple's Interfaces are Retarded

Zork the Almighty Zork the Almighty writes  |  more than 9 years ago I understand why everybody likes Apple's interfaces. If you try to do something simple, it usually works. However, for more complex or repetative tasks there is generally no good way to do various things. Worse still, the UI gets in your way. For example:

In iPhoto, I already have my photos organized into directories. When I import them, I get film rolls corresponding to my directories. So far so good. However, the files can not be sorted by anything inside the film rolls, so when I do a slideshow it is all out of order. No sweat, you say, I can just make albums from each film roll. Have you ever tried creating multiple albums in this program ? Good god! It is fucking terrible! You have to drag each one - the command "make album from selection" is greyed out if you select a film roll - then it switches to the album, and you have to scroll up the list back to the photo library, locate the next album, and continue. Honestly, this program is fucking irritating.

(update) Ackk! It's even worse than I first believed. There is no way to automatically sort all albums by filename either. Why Apple, Why ?!! Why does it have to suck so bad ?!! Auggghhh!!!

top

Current Keyboards and Mice are Crap

Zork the Almighty Zork the Almighty writes  |  about 10 years ago

Is it just me, or is it impossible to buy a normal keyboard and mouse these days. Every keyboard now has at least ten "multimedia" or "internet" keys, and god help you if you want a mouse without a scroll wheel. I have on my desk a fairly ordinary keyboard (although it has those blasted "windows" keys) and a Logitech 3-button mouse. I dread the day when I have to replace the mouse. Does anyone have a source for "no-shit" keyboards and mice ? I'd be very interested.

Slashdot Login

Need an Account?

Forgot your password?

Submission Text Formatting Tips

We support a small subset of HTML, namely these tags:

  • b
  • i
  • p
  • br
  • a
  • ol
  • ul
  • li
  • dl
  • dt
  • dd
  • em
  • strong
  • tt
  • blockquote
  • div
  • quote
  • ecode

"ecode" can be used for code snippets, for example:

<ecode>    while(1) { do_something(); } </ecode>